Rejuvenating the Body, Mending Muscles: Ayurvedic Therapies for Myopathy
Ayurveda, an ancient knowledge system originating from India, offers a holistic approach to healing and well-being. Understanding myopathies, conditions that involve the muscles, as imbalances within the body's energy channels, Ayurveda utilizes unique therapies to mend muscle health.
One such therapy is Abhyanga, a full-body massage using warm herbal oils that encourages circulation and strengthens the muscles. Another effective practice is Shirodhara, where warm oil is gently poured onto the forehead, calming the nervous system and easing muscle tension.
Ayurvedic remedies, often derived from herbs like Ashwagandha and Turmeric, are also utilized to combat inflammation and pain associated with myopathies.
By addressing the root cause of the imbalance rather than merely treating the symptoms, Ayurveda provides a path to continuous muscle health and overall well-being.

Exploring the Secrets of Ayurveda: Effective Treatments for Myopathy
Ayurveda, an ancient Indian system of healing, offers holistic treatments for myopathy, a disorder characterized by muscle weakness and pain. Healers in Ayurveda believe that imbalances in the body's three energies - Vata, Pitta, and Kapha - contribute to the development of myopathy. To restore these energies, Ayurveda utilizes a variety of methods, including:
- Plant-based remedies: Specific herbs are known for their muscle-strengthening properties.
- Dietary changes: Ayurveda emphasizes a diet rich in fresh fruits, vegetables, and grains, while limiting processed foods, sugar, and caffeine.
- Massage therapy: Gentle massage techniques improve blood circulation and help ease muscles.
By addressing the root causes of myopathy through these Ayurveda-based treatments, individuals can experience relief from muscle weakness, pain, and other symptoms.
